如何使用lower函数查询数据库中的小写数据? (lower数据库)

在数据库中查询数据是非常常见的操作,lower函数可以将字符串转化为小写形式。在数据库中,lower函数被广泛地用于查询数据,尤其当需要查找一个字符串在数据库中是否存在时,lower函数可以将该字符串转换成小写形式,然后进行查询。在本文中,我们将介绍如何使用lower函数查询数据库中的小写数据。

一、为什么要使用lower函数

1.1、数据库大小写敏感

在进行数据库查询时,有时候用户所输入的字符串的大小写并不确定,而数据库是大小写敏感的,这时候就需要将用户输入的字符串转换成小写形式进行查询。例如,在MySQL数据库中,将一个字符串转换成小写形式的函数是lower()函数。

1.2、查询更为准确

在某些情况下,数据库中存储的数据可能并不是全部小写形式。如果直接将用户输入的字符串与数据库中的数据进行比较,那么就会出现大小写不一致导致查询失败的情况。使用lower函数将字符串转换成小写形式之后,可以避免这种情况的出现,提高查询的准确性。

二、使用lower函数查询数据库中的小写数据

下面将以MySQL为例,介绍如何使用lower函数查询数据库中的小写数据。

2.1、创建数据表

我们需要在MySQL数据库中创建一个数据表,用于存放需要查询的数据。下面的示例代码创建了一个名为person的数据表。

CREATE TABLE person (

id INT PRIMARY KEY AUTO_INCREMENT,

name VARCHAR(255) NOT NULL,

age INT NOT NULL,

address VARCHAR(255) NOT NULL

);

该数据表包含三个字段,分别为id、name、age和address,其中id为自增长字段,name、age和address分别表示人员姓名、年龄和地址。

2.2、插入数据

接下来,我们需要往person数据表中插入一些数据,用于后续查询。下面的示例代码向person数据表中插入了5条数据。

INSERT INTO person (name, age, address)

VALUES (‘Tom’, 20, ‘Beijing’),

(‘Jack’, 22, ‘Shangh’),

(‘John’, 25, ‘Guangzhou’),

(‘Mike’, 28, ‘Hangzhou’),

(‘Lily’, 23, ‘Nanjing’);

2.3、查询数据

在已经插入了数据的基础上,我们可以使用lower函数查询person数据表中的小写数据。下面的示例代码使用lower函数查询person数据表中的地址中包含“hangzhou”字符串的数据。

SELECT *

FROM person

WHERE LOWER(address) LIKE ‘%hangzhou%’;

该代码中的LOWER函数将address字段中的数据全部转换成小写形式,然后与含有“hangzhou”子字符串的数据进行比较,以此进行数据查询。

三、小结

通过本文的介绍,读者可以了解到lower函数在数据库查询中的应用。通过将字符串转换成小写形式,可以提高查询的准确性,避免因为大小写不一致导致查询失败的情况。在实际的应用中,读者可以根据自己所使用的数据库自行使用lower函数查询数据库中的小写数据,以此提高查询效率和准确性。

相关问题拓展阅读:

对数据库的数据进行“忽略大小写”的查询?

SQL> create table test (name varchar2(20));

表已创建。

已用时间: 00: 00: 00.03

SQL> insert into test values(‘N’);

已创建 1 行。

已用时间: 00: 00: 00.04

SQL> insert into test values(‘n’);

已创建 1 行。凳亮

已用时间: 00: 00: 00.00

SQL> commit;

提交完成。

已用时间: 00: 00: 00.04

SQL> select * from test where name like ‘N%’;

NAME

——

N

已用时间: 00: 00: 00.03

SQL> select * from test where upper(name) like ‘N%’;

NAME

——

N

n

大体意思应该是这样,对where里的字竖模段进行upper或lower的转换,然后进余粗缓行查询即可

股票k线中的lower是什么意思

因为我们相信市场无形的手会给你股票一个公允的定价,尽管这个定价会发生波动。本杰明·格雷厄姆的“市场先生寓言”可以很好的解释K线所表示的股价的意义。

本杰明·格雷厄姆的”市场先生”寓言故事说的是:”设想你在与一个叫市场亮雀大先生的人进行股票交易,每天市场先生一定会提出一个他乐意购买你的股票或将他的股票卖给你的价格,市场先生的情绪很不稳定,因此,在有些日子市场先生很快活,只看到眼前美好的日子,这时市场先生就会报出很高的价格,其他日子,市场先生却相当懊丧只看到眼前的困难,报出的价格很低。另外市场先生还有一个可爱的特点,他不介意被人冷落,如果市场先生所说的话被人忽略了,他明天还会回来同时提出他的新报价。市场先生对我们有用的是他口袋中的报价,敬竖而不是他的智慧,如果市场先生看起来不太正常你就可以忽视他或者利用他这个弱点。但是如果你完全被他控制后果将不堪设想。”

我们看价格又不能只看价格,同一价格代表的背后资产的价格可能不同。针对同一只股票的价格,我们可以采取一些类似于PE band等曲线识别其投资机会。

趋势

K线的趋岁正势及其产生的各类指标,虽然大都会有“后验”的缺点,但是这并不耽误我们的使用。因为历史会重复,但不会简单地重复!人性中的缺点并不会随着代际的变化发生骤变,羊群效应永远存在。由于K线有非常强的时间相关性,利用这种特性,可以轻易的组出很多胜率高的指标。MACD、KDJ、BOLL等等,这些再其统计的周期内,可以给我们以周期维度的参考,但一般都不是我们的买入卖出充分条件,可以作为我们的辅助判断。

K线的指标就不放图了,大家可以学着看看,了解内在的逻辑,不要看指标买股就好了。

炒股不看K线的都是 ,炒股只看k线的都是。

Md是中值。middle 的缩写。upper 是一天中股价的更高值。lower 是一天中股价的更低值

一、心态要沉静

“万物静中得”。一个人只有在自己心境最沉静的时候,作出的判断才是最准确的。因此,每个人在盯宏准备进行抄底投资时,最忌讳心浮气躁,只有冷静客观地分析各种信息,不被估算的收益冲昏头脑,才能不于受别人的言论或者行为的影响,正确挑选适合自己的抄底投资项目。

二、住诱惑

生意场上没有常胜将军,进行抄底投资更是如此。因凯春册此,想要成长为一个成功的抄底高手,首先必须具备一个平和的心态。看到好的投资项目,如果自己没有足够的信心与能力去投资,那要做的就只有等待。只有及时调整自己,诱惑,以一种平和的心态面对,才能做到理智森升投资。

三、耐心等待机会

无论我们做任何事情,只有耐心等待,才有捕捉到更佳的机会。抄底高手知道,要想成功投资,不是一朝一夕的事情,它需要有足够的耐心去等待,只有量积累到一定的程度,它才会发生质的变化。

四、失败是成功之母

不管做哪一种行业都会有失败者,我们如果从失败者身上汲取教训,就可以避免很多弯路。松下幸之助先生曾经说过:“我不会对从来没有过失败体验之人委以重任,我担心任命后他就开始之一次失败,那么我就成为了他之一次失败的受害者。”

五、坚持就是赢家

“不管是谁,所做的是什么生意,都是机遇与风险各占一半。你需要凭借着自己的经验抓住每一次赚钱的机会,而且还要勇敢扛着随时到来的风险,这样一直坚持下去,最终才能取得成功。”

什么是BOLL线

BOLL线又称为布林线指标,是研判股价运动趋势的一种中长期技术分析工具。该指标在图形中显示出三条线,由三条轨道线组成,其中上下两条线分别可以看成是股价的压力线(UPER,即上轨)和支撑线(LOWER,即下轨),在两条线之间是一条股价平均线(MID,即中轨)。通常情况下,价格线在由上下轨道间游走,而且随价格的变化而自动调整轨道的位置。

一、布林线分类:

1、布林线往上张口——加速上涨

K线沿着布林线上轨在滑行,这段K线就是鱼身部位了,应对的策略就是持股不动,让利润奔跑。

LOWER是“布林线指标”中的下轨。布林线(BOLL)由约翰 布林先生创造,其利用统计原理,求出股价的标准差及其信赖区间,从而确定股价的波动范围及未来走势,利用波带显示股价的安全高低价位,因而也被称为布林带。

在股市分析软件中,BOLL指标一共由四条线组成,即上轨线UP 、中轨线MB、下轨线LOWER和价格线李弊返。其中上轨线UP是UP数值的连线,用黄色线表示;中轨线MB是MB数值的连线,用白色线表示;下轨线LOWER是LOWER数值的连线,用紫色线表示;价格线是以美国线表示,颜色为浅蓝色。一般来说股价在上轨有压力,股价在下轨有支撑。

其他回答卜好

这三个线其实是一个独哪饥立的指标系统,统称为“布林线指标”。

,mid是

中轨,upper是上轨,lower是下轨。一般来说股价在

上轨有压力,股价在

下轨有

股票里的k线什么意思

股票k线图各颜色什么意思

五分钟教你看懂k线图

k线均线各是什么意思

股票k线是什么意思

股票k线十字星组图解

股票金手指k线是什么意思

股票什么是k线图解

12种绝佳买入形态k线图

初学者如何看盘及k线图

k线72口诀图解

LOWER是“布林线指标”中的下轨。布林线(BOLL)由约翰 布林先生创余键贺造,其利用统计原理,求出股价的标准差及其信赖区间,从而确定股价的波动范围及未来走势,竖派利用波带显示股价的安全高低价位,因而也被称为布林带。

在股市分析软件中,BOLL指标一共由四条线组成,即上轨线UP 、中轨线MB、下轨线LOWER和价格线。其中上轨线UP是UP数值的连线,用黄色线表示;中轨线MB是MB数值的连线,用白色线表示;下轨线LOWER是LOWER数值的连线,用紫色线表示;价格线是以美国线表示,颜色为浅亮纯蓝色。一般来说股价在上轨有压力,股价在下轨有支撑。

mysql在更改lower_case_table_names=后,原大写数据表查找失败

lower_case_table_names=1会让mysql不区分大小写表名的念帆呀,然后你可以使用

alter table 表名 rename to 新表名

来进行修改表名既可以解决问消备题,然后再重启一遍拿高毁,这是更好的办法。

关于lower数据库的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


数据运维技术 » 如何使用lower函数查询数据库中的小写数据? (lower数据库)